Subject: Key rotation — GreenPulse scheduler API

Plugin authors,

We're rotating credentials for the GreenPulse watering scheduler effective Friday. Old keys stop working at cutover; no grace period this time. If your plugin calls the schedule, moisture, or zone endpoints, swap keys before then. Rate limits and endpoints are unchanged. Staging already runs on the new credential set, so test there first. Questions go to the plugin channel. The new key for the internal scheduler service follows below.

API key for tawep-fawip: zpat15_Ngeaqpk5w7LhWo5

### Encoding detection for uploaded text files

Adds a two-pass detector to the Quillbox intake pipeline. First pass checks BOMs and validates strict UTF-8; second pass falls back to statistical detection over a bounded sample. Files below the confidence floor are tagged `encoding_unknown` and routed to manual review rather than transcoded — lossy guesses broke imports before, so don't lower the floor casually. Sample size, confidence thresholds, and fallback order are centralized in one module. The tuning constants are as follows.

tuning constants:
QUOTAS = {
    "druwyn": 5,
    "holix": 5,
    "zorath": 5,
    "holwyn": 10,
}

Ticket FM-0457: Locker assignments for the basement changing rooms at Marrowgate House have been updated. New starter Pella Durnin is assigned locker 22B, left bank, nearest the showers. Reception should hand over the padlock and confirm the locker is empty before sign-off. To open the changing room corridor door for her, use the access code below.

badge for yahag-yajep: bdg-N-77